Commercial Roof

massive organizations most of the time prefer a roofing business that can supply industrial roofing services that would not greatly interfere their routine business operations. There are several roofing contractors that provide special services for commercial residential or commercial properties such as leaving car park devoid of debris and clearing entranceways of any blockages so that your company can run undisturbed. There are numerous types of roof to pick from for your industrial structure. The selection would mainly depend on the expense, the slope of your roofing, and the weather in your area. Asphalt shingles are the most often used kind of shingles both on commercial and domestic roofing structures. Reinforced with wood fibers, fiberglass or some organic materials, asphalt shingles can last to 2-3 years. Laminated shingles are likewise made from asphalt however are offered in a wider variety of colors and textures that make it appear more pricey shake or slate tiles. Metal roofings are expected to last between 30 to 50 years and are substantially less expensive than asphalt shingles if appropriately set up. This type of roofing product can stand up to most of severe weather condition but have actually been understood to damage after some time. Cooper is another alternative to consider, although it is much expensive than aluminum. With copper roofs, you can expect it to last up to 100 years. When it comes to wood shakes particularly for commercial roof, Cedar is the top option. Common expense of wood shake application can add to 50% higher than other roofing applications. Slate shingles are considerably much heavier and more difficult to mount. They are likewise quite delicate however can definitely include charm and elegance to any structure.

material to consider for you industrial roof requirements. Tiles are typically made from concrete, rubber or clay. Clay tiles are more costly than concrete tiles however they are generally the same in regards to performance and durability. Tiles are a lot heavier than other roof products, so you may require additional structural support for your roofing.

Flat Roofs

Flat roofings are an excellent way to keep a structure safe from water. Knowing exactly what to do with a flat roofing will guarantee you have a working roof system that will last a long time.

They may look great, and are extremely typical, flat roofs do need regular upkeep and detailed repair in order to effectively avoid water infiltration. You'll be pleased with your flat roofing system for a really long time if this is done properly.

Flat roofing systems aren't as attractive and/or popular as its more recent equivalents, such as copper, slate, or tile roofs. They are just as essential and require even more attention. In order to prevent getting rid of cash on short-term repair work, you should know precisely how flat roofing systems are designed, the numerous kinds of flat roofings that are readily available, and the importance of routine examination and upkeep.

A flat roofing system works by providing a waterproof membrane over a building. It includes one or more layers of hydrophobic materials that is positioned over a structural deck with a vapor barrier that is typically put between roofing membrane.

Flashing, or thin strips of material such as copper, converge with the membrane and the other structure components to prevent water infiltration. The water is then directed to drains, downspouts, and seamless gutters by the roofing's slight pitch.

There are 4 most common types of flat roofing systems. Noted in order of increasing toughness and cost, they are: roll asphalt, single-ply membrane, multiple-ply or built-up, and flat-seamed metal. They can vary anywhere from as low as $2 per square foot for roll asphalt or single-ply roofing that is applied over and existing roofing, to $20 per square foot or more for brand-new metal roofing systems.

Used since the 1890s, asphalt roll roofing typically consists of one layer of asphalt-saturated natural or fiberglass base felts that are used over roofing felt with nails and cold asphalt cement and generally covered with a granular mineral surface area. The joints are usually covered over with a roofing compound. It can last about 10 years.

Single-ply membrane roofing is the most recent kind of roofing product. It is frequently utilized to change multiple-ply roofings. 10 to 12 year warranties are typical, however correct setup is important and upkeep is still required.

Multiple-ply or built-up roofing, likewise referred to as BUR, is made from overlapping rolls of saturated or coated felts or mats that are interspersed with layers of bitumen and surfaced with a granular roofing ballast, sheet, or tile pavers that are utilized to secure the hidden materials from the weather. BURs are developed to last 10 to 30 years, which depends upon the materials utilized.

Ballast, or aggregate, of crushed stone or water-worn gravel is embedded in a covering of asphalt or coal tar. Considering that the ballast or tile pavers cover the membrane, it makes checking and maintaining the joints of the roofing system difficult.

Last but not least, flat-seamed roofing systems have actually been utilized considering that the 19 th century. Made from small pieces of sheet metal soldered flush at the joints, it can last lots of decades depending on the quality of the material, maintenance, and exposure to the aspects.

Galvanized metal does require routine painting in order to prevent rust and split seams require to be resoldered. Other metal surfaces, such as copper, can end up being pitted and pinholed from acid raid and usually needs replacing. Today copper, lead-coated copper, and terne-coated stainless steel are favored as lasting flat roofing systems.
